Structural engineer services involve assessing the integrity and stability of buildings and structures to ensure they meet safety standards and are capable of withstanding various loads and forces. These professionals analyze existing conditions or proposed designs, often conducting detailed inspections and evaluations. Their assessments help identify potential issues such as foundation settlement, structural weaknesses, or design flaws that could compromise safety or performance. By providing expert recommendations, they assist property owners and builders in making informed decisions about repairs, reinforcements, or modifications needed to maintain structural safety.
These services are essential for addressing a range of structural problems, including cracks in walls, uneven flooring, or signs of foundation movement. They help solve issues related to structural deterioration, damage from environmental factors, or the effects of construction modifications. Structural engineers also play a vital role in evaluating the safety of structures before renovation or expansion projects, ensuring that existing frameworks can support new loads or alterations. Their evaluations can prevent costly failures and help property owners avoid future hazards caused by compromised structural elements.
Properties that typically utilize structural engineering services include residential homes, comm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and public infrastructure. Residential properties may require assessments before remodeling, foundation repairs, or additions. Commercial properties often need structural evaluations for new construction, tenant improvements, or retrofitting to meet safety codes. Industrial facilities with large equipment or heavy loads may also benefit from structural assessments to confirm stability and safety. Public structures such as bridges, schools, or community centers may require periodic inspections to maintain compliance with safety standards and prevent structural failures.

Design Consultation Fees - Structural engineering consultation costs typically range from $100 to $300 per hour, depending on project complexity. For example, a basic review may cost around $150, while detailed assessments could reach $250 or more.
Structural Analysis Costs - Performing structural analysis services gener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for standard residential projects. Larger or more complex structures may incur fees exceeding $4,000.
Drafting and Design Fees - Drafting services for structural plans usually fall within the $500 to $2,500 range. Simple modifications might cost closer to $600, whereas comprehensive design work can be around $2,000 or higher.
Additional Service Charges - Extra services such as site inspections or report preparations often add $200 to $800 per visit. Costs vary based on project scope and location specifics in Lake Zurich, IL and n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is the role of a structural engineer? Structural engineers assess and design the framework of buildings and structures to ensure safety and stability.
When should I consider hiring a structural engineer? A structural engineer can be contacted for foundation assessments, remodeling projects, or when structural issues are suspected.
How do structural engineers work with contractors? They collaborate with contractors to review plans, provide specifications, and ensure structural integrity during construction.
What types of structures do structural engineers typically work on? They work on residential, commercial, and industrial buildings, as well as bridges and other load-bearing structures.
